How much does a Diversity Specialist I make in Utah? The average Diversity Specialist I salary in Utah is $63,936 as of March 26, 2024, but the range typically falls between $56,655 and $71,684. Salary ranges can vary widely depending on the city and many other important factors, including education, certifications, additional skills, the number of years you have spent in your profession.
Percentile | Salary | Location | Last Updated |
10th Percentile Diversity Specialist I Salary | $50,026 | UT | March 26, 2024 |
25th Percentile Diversity Specialist I Salary | $56,655 | UT | March 26, 2024 |
50th Percentile Diversity Specialist I Salary | $63,936 | UT | March 26, 2024 |
75th Percentile Diversity Specialist I Salary | $71,684 | UT | March 26, 2024 |
90th Percentile Diversity Specialist I Salary | $78,738 | UT | March 26, 2024 |

Diversity Specialist I administers programs that promote employee and vendor diversity. Ensures compliance with internal polices and external diversity regulations. Being a Diversity Specialist I fosters knowledge and adoption of diversity, equity, and inclusion topics and best practices. Ensures organization employs strategies to attract, develop, and retain members of underrepresented groups. Additionally, Diversity Specialist I compiles statistics, metrics, and reports to assess the progress and effectiveness of diversity initiatives. May be responsible for delivering diversity training. Requires a bachelor's degree or equivalent. Typically reports to a manager or head of a unit/department. The Diversity Specialist I work is closely managed. Works on projects/matters of limited complexity in a support role. To be a Diversity Specialist I typically requires 0-2 years of related experience. (Copyright 2024 Salary.com)...
